What Are the Best Tools for Lesson Planning?

Lesson planning can consume hours of an educator’s weekend. Generative AI tools are excellent at creating initial drafts, brainstorming activities, and differentiating content for various reading levels.

  • ChatGPT: The standard for generating ideas, structuring rubrics, and rewriting texts to be simpler or more complex.
  • MagicSchool.ai: A dedicated platform for educators featuring dozens of specific generators for IEP goals, quizzes, and syllabus creation.

How Can AI Help with Grading and Feedback?

Grading is often the most significant administrative burden teachers face.

  • Gradescope: While it has existed for years, its AI-assisted grading for handwritten math and science assignments has vastly improved, allowing teachers to grade a single question across all student papers simultaneously.
  • Claude: With its large context window, Claude is excellent for providing initial feedback on long essays based on a specific rubric you provide.

Which AI Tools Boost Student Engagement?

AI can also be used directly with students to foster interaction and creativity.

  • Khanmigo: Khan Academy’s AI tutor acts as a guide, refusing to give students the direct answer but instead asking Socratic questions to help them arrive at the solution themselves.
  • Canva: For visual projects, AI image generation allows students to bring historical events or creative writing assignments to life visually.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it cheating if I use AI to write lesson plans?

No, using AI for lesson planning is a time-saving productivity tool, much like using a search engine or template.

Can AI accurately grade student essays?

AI can provide excellent preliminary feedback and grammar checks, but final grading should always involve human judgment.

How do I prevent students from using AI to cheat?

Focus on in-class assignments, oral presentations, or prompt students to use AI transparently as a research assistant and cite their prompts.

Are these AI tools FERPA compliant?

Always check the specific tool’s privacy policy. Tools designed specifically for education often have strict data privacy standards.
